Opening Times of Boat & Yacht Dealers stores in Edinburgh

Found businesses: 4

No rating yet
Reviews: 0
Tel: 0131 629 5092
6 Quayside St, Edinburgh,
No rating yet
Reviews: 0
Tel: 0131 554 1129
34 Bernard Street, Edinburgh,
No rating yet
Reviews: 0
Tel: 07853 352750
374 Easter Rd, Edinburgh, EH6 8JW